C言語作為一門基本的編程言語,供給了多種方法來實現數值的乘積運算。本文將介紹在C言語中怎樣利用標準庫函數跟自定義函數來求積。 總結來說,C言語標準庫中並不直接求積的函數,因為乘法運算是經由過程算術運算符*實現的。但是,我們可能本人編寫函數來實現這一功能,並且可能利用標準庫中的函數停止幫助打算。
具體描述:
-
標準算術運算符*:在C言語中,兩個數相乘最直接的方法就是利用乘法運算符*。比方: int product = a * b; 這裡的變數a跟b是要相乘的兩個整數。
-
自定義求積函數:假如須要重複停止乘法操縱,可能將乘法操縱封裝成一個函數,如下所示: int multiply(int x, int y) { return x * y; } 利用這個函數,我們可能經由過程挪用multiply(a, b)來掉掉落a跟b的乘積。
-
利用標準庫函數:固然在求積運算中並不罕見,但假如涉及到複雜數學打算,可能會用到標準庫中的數學函數。比方,假如須要打算浮點數的乘積,可能利用math.h頭文件中定義的函數。 double product = a * b; 這裡a跟b可能是double範例的變數,直接相乘即可。
總結: C言語本身不特定的函數來求積,因為乘法操縱是基本的算術運算,經由過程運算符*即可實現。編寫自定義函數可能使得代碼愈加模塊化,易於保護跟重用。在現實編程中,根據須要抉擇合適的方法來停止乘法運算。